Not surprisingly, the hearing yesterday on “greater transparency” in the meat processing industry achieved little in the way of greater understanding. The American Meat Institute, however, used the opportunity to unveil a new initiative that it says will make meat-related information more accessible for consumers.
Dr. Richard Raymond, the USDA’s under secretary for food safety, told the Committee on Oversight and Government Reform’s subcommittee for domestic policy that the agency doesn’t need more inspectors, and that the idea of videotaping meat plants is costly and impractical, according to The Baltimore Sun.
Committee members reportedly were unimpressed by Dr. Raymond’s testimony: “We’re trying to look for solutions. If you would work with us, that would help,” Rep. Diane E. Watson (D.-Calif.) is quoted as saying.
Dr. Raymond was the first of 10 total witnesses scheduled to appear at the hearing.
